Lauren was born and raised in Mendham, New Jersey where she won 3 State Sectional Championships, 2 County Championships, and 2 Conference Championships as a player for Mendham High School. She went on to play at Rowan University where she won 1 Conference Championship and made 3 Division III NCAA tournament appearances. Originally a defensive midfielder, Lauren was forced to miss her sophomore season due to illness before returning to the field her junior year in a new role as an attacker. During her senior year at Rowan, Lauren was the team leader in assists and the co-leader in overall points. She graduated from Rowan with a Bachelor of Science in Finance and later earned her Masters in Education.
Immediately following college, Lauren began coaching youth, high school, and club lacrosse. She spent six years coaching club lacrosse for STEPS Elite in NJ and high school lacrosse at Oak Knoll School and Mendham High School in New Jersey. She has also won both state and conference titles as a coach. Since moving to California in the Fall of 2016, Lauren has been involved in coaching at the youth, high school, and club level. She is currently the Girls Director at Ross Valley Lacrosse Club and the head coach at Redwood High School.
